Basic Dragon Ritual

Set up your altar so that it faces east. Make sure that it is known that you are not to be disturbed once your circle is cast.

Go to the east of your magickal space, and with your sword in your power hand, "draw" your magickal circle on the floor around the ritual area. To do this, point the sword at the floor and visualize great flames shooting from it. Move clockwise around the circle with this flame; end it by overlapping the ends of the circle in the east. While you draw this circle, say : By dragon power, this circle is sealed.

Return to the altar. Point the sword at the dragon pentacle and say :

Dragons of Spirit, highest of dragons and most powerful, bless this altar with your fire. Let us be one in magick, O dragons great and wise.

Set the water chalice on the pentacle. With the wand in your power hand, circle the chalice three times clockwise with the wand and say :

Air, Fire, Earth, bring power forth. Water of land and sea, purified be.

Hold the chalice up, and say :

Draconis! Draconis! Draconis!

Sprinkle the water from the chalice lightly around the Circle, beginning and ending in the east.

Set the dish of salt on the pentacle. Circle it three times clockwise with the wand and say :

Water, Air, Fire, hear my desire. Salt of Earth and sea, purified be.

Sprinkle a few grains of salt to each corner of the altar. Circle the incense burner three times with the wand, and say:

Fire of dragons, fire of Earth,

You are purified. Bring power forth.

Circle the incense and herbs three times clockwise with the wand. Say :

Incense magickal, incense bold, Awake the dragons, as of old. I call you purified.

Put a small amount of incense onto the burning coals in the incense burner. Lift the burner by the chains and touch it lightly to the pentacle. Lift it high over the altar, and say : Draconis! Draconis! Draconis!

Then carry the incense burner clockwise around the Circle, beginning and ending in the east. Return it to the altar.

Kneel before the altar with the sword held in both hands. Mentally dedicate yourself to the study of dragon magick. Project your interest and love of dragons as strongly as you can. Continue this for several minutes. Then rise, point the sword at the dragon pentacle, and say :

Behold, all dragons and rulers of dragons, I am (magickal name), a magician who seeks dragon magick. With (name of sword) in my hand, I enter the realms of the dragons, Not for physical battle, but for knowledge and power. I greet you, O dragons ancient and wise, And await your blessing and guidance.

Continue holding the sword outstretched until you feel the blessings of the dragons.

When the power of the blessing has lessened, lower the sword. Still holding the sword in your power hand, take the dragon pentacle in your other hand and go to the east. Point the sword at the eastern position and hold up the dragon pentacle facing outward. Draw an invoking pentagram with the sword. Say :

From Sairys, ruler of the eastern dragons fair, Comes now the wondrous power of Air.

Feel the power of Air entering your body. When the flow stops, go to the south. Hold up the pentacle again. Draw an invoking pentagram with the sword and say :

From Fafnir, ruler of dragons of the south, Comes cleansing Fire from dragon mouth.

Feel the power of Fire entering your body. When the flow of power stops, go to the west. Again hold up the pentacle, and draw an invoking pentagram with the sword. Say :

From Naelyan, ruler of dragons of the west, Comes the power of Water, three times blest.

Draw into yourself the power of Water. Go to the north. Hold up the pentacle, and draw an invoking pentagram with the sword. Say :

From Grael, ruler of dragons of the north, The power of Earth does now come forth.

Draw into yourself the power of Earth. Return to the altar. Set aside the sword and dragon pentacle. Add the herbal incense to the incense burner.

(At this point in your ritual, insert the proper chants and workings for the particular spellworking or meditation that you have chosen.)

If you have a problem that you have not been able to solve by physical means or by magick, you may ask the dragons at this time for advice. They will be able to give you new insight into ways of solving it. Continue to feel their power and direction as you write down the instructions.

When finished with the spellworking, tap the staff three times and chant :

I thank you, dragons old and wise, Of Earth and Fire, Water, Skies, For sharing wisdom here with me. As we will, so shall it be.

Always approach dragons as equals, not as a force to be ordered around or conquered.

Set the wine chalice on the pentacle. Circle it three times clockwise with the wand, and say : Cup of power, cup of might, Dragon magick, be here this night.

Drink the wine (or juice, if you wish to substitute), saving some to be poured outside on the ground later as an offering to the dragons. (If it is not possible to pour the offering outside, leave it on the altar for an hour or so.)

Now is an excellent time to chant and use free-form dancing. Invite the dragons to share in the raised energy and your joy of being a magician. Talk to them about your hopes and dreams. And listen to see if they have suggestions or words of encouragement for you. This is an opportunity for close friendships to be formed.

To close the ritual, take the sword and go to the east. Draw a banishing pentagram

with the sword, and say : Go in peace, dragons of the East. And return again in the ritual hour.

Go to the south, draw a banishing pentagram with the sword, and say : Go in peace, dragons of the South. And return again in the ritual hour.

Go to the west, draw a banishing pentagram with the sword, and say : Go in peace, dragons of the West. And return again in the ritual hour.

Finish by going to the north. Draw a banishing pentagram with the sword, and say : Go in peace, dragons of the North. And return again at the ritual hour.

Return to the altar. Raise both arms and say :

Farewell to you, O dragons fair,

Fire, Water, Earth, and Air.

Together we make magick well

By power deep and dragon spell.

In peace go now. Return once more

To teach me magick and ancient lore.

Draconis! Draconis! Draconis!

Cut the Circle with a backward sweep of the sword across the boundary line. Extinguish the altar candles, and clear the altar of all tools.
